I borrowed some electric bicycles and went for a Kamakura Tour with my friends. It was awesome! It rained a lot and it got in the way of filming but it was still a lot of fun!??I highly recommend the “Zeni-Arai Jinja”, or the money washing temple. You are supposed to take your money and wash it under the spring water. I washed a bit more than a few coins.
